I BELIEVE IN absolute oneness of God and, therefore, also of humanity. What though we have many bodies? We have but one soul. The rays of the sun are many through refraction. But they have the same source. I cannot therefore detach myself from the wickedest soul (nor may I be denied identity with the most virtuous). Whether, therefore, I will or not, I must involve in my experiment, the whole of my kind. Nor can I do without experiment. Life is but an endless series of experiments. Break through the crust of limitation and India becomes one family. If all limitations vanish, the whole world becomes one family, which it really is. Not to cross these bars is to become callous to all fine feelings, which make a man.

No Religious Divisions

If a free India is to live at peace with herself, religious division must entirely give place to political division based on considerations other than religious. Even as it is, though unfortunately religious differences loom large, most parties contain members drawn from various sects.

No Privileged Class

No privileges should be given to anyone in the new India. It is the poor and neglected and downtrodden and weak that should be our special care and attention. A Brahmana should not grudge if more money is spent on the uplift of the Harijans. At the same time, a Brahmana may not be done down simply because he is a Brahmana … It is the duty of every citizen to treat the lowliest on a par with the others.
